    THIS PLACE IS TERRIBLE! It may be a beautiful facility and look clean; however, the care and the…read morefood are terrible. THIS IS NOT THE PLACE TO SEND A LOVED ONE IF THEY NEED WOUND CARE OR OSTOMY CARE! I toured the facility before moving my grandma there, and they assured me that they had adequate staffing, great wound care, and were knowledgeable about ileostomies. This turned out to be completely false! I had to come and care for her many times due to their incompetence when it came to adhering the ostomy bag. I also had to purchase several medical supplies needed for it because they said that they could not get them. There is no excuse for this! It is all covered and supplied through her insurance. They would not regularly empty the bag as required, and it would constantly leak. Because they were doing it incorrectly, they were changing it up to 5 times a day, which is unheard of! An ostomy bag holds, on average, for 3 to 5 days when it is done correctly and emptied on schedule. Her wound stayed infected the entire time she was there and grew in size. It became so bad that when we left the facility, her doctor had to make it larger and start a wound vac. One staff member even swatted at my grandma's hand when they were changing her ostomy, and my grandma wanted to help. They were accusing my grandma of "fiddling with it" and causing it to leak. I really should have reported this facility to the state, but I did not have the time or energy. I hope our experience will help others find a better place for their loved one, and that this facility will take a good, long look at what is going on with the care they provide and make changes. I hope they will be honest with themselves and others when they consider accepting patients who need this type of care. I will commend the therapy staff. The only thing this place has going for them is great physical, occupational, and speech therapy. So if that is all you need, it might be an okay fit for you, but be aware of the nursing staff.
